Transaction 55d95243cd5705ca76cb310d8b9c7c8540e47f42e21ee2e60d371c21bc43a37e

1 Input
2 Outputs
  • 55d95243cd5705ca76cb310d8b9c7c8540e47f42e21ee2e60d371c21bc43a37e:0
  • value  28046055
    address  15VVhHC8tUycdZ2NjsATYrEArNPgUZK6jn
  • 55d95243cd5705ca76cb310d8b9c7c8540e47f42e21ee2e60d371c21bc43a37e:1
  • value  1274552294
    address  1B1wn4FR8KpxTLGSNk4LFkMG6MyhcCeNuj